Snow
Day at the Zoo!
The
recent spat of cold weather and days of snow were
great fun for several of the animals here at Woodland
Park Zoo. In particular, our snow leopards had a great
romp as the two sisters and their mother raced around
their exhibit. Snow leopards hail from the cold, high-altitudes
of Central Asia, so this blast of winter was like a
touch of their native land. Sightings of wild snow
leopards are extremely uncommon and so watching these
highly endangered cats at play is a rare treat.
